From a special section of the Waldron News newspaper of 23 April 1981, consisting of interviews of Scott County citizens 80 Years of age and over. The interviews were done as part of a celebration of the Bank of Waldron's 80th anniversary.

NEAL M. FROST

Neal M. Frost was born in Clarksville, Arkansas on March 15, 1898 to John L. Frost and Emmaline Bean Frost. He now resides in Waldron. He has been a long time member of the Methodist Church, a Master Mason, a Royal Arch Mason and a 32 degree Mason and also a member of the Order of the Eastern Star. He served as president and vice president of his Sunday School Class for several years, also serving in other offices of the church. He was the first legally elected mayor of Damascus, Arkansas serving four years. He worked 36 years as shipping and receiving auditor for Ford Motor Co. in Detroit, Michigan. One of his outstanding memories was with Ford Motor Co. and this was seeing the last Model T roll off the assembly line and the first Model A roll off the assembly line. During his years with Ford Motor he saw many different models come and go. After retirement his hobby was refinishing antique furniture until his health prevented it. Some of his work has gone as far as Twin Falls, Idaho and Harrison, Damascus, Clinton, Conway, Forrest City and Hot Springs.
